I'm hoping someone with a good ear can help me identify what type of fuzz is being used in these two songs or a circuit that can get close.

Goat - "Let It Burn"

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=pGSl3nHBjYU

Sleepy Sun - "Marina"

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=xOrQoqDtwyg

I'm guessing the second one is some kind of Big Muff? Sounds somewhat close to Sleepy Silver Door by Dead Meadow. I don't have a clue on the first one. Either way, I appreciate the help!

Both of them sound pretty big muffy to me, just dial the tone knob up on the Muff and for the Sleepy Sun thing use something like a Rat in front of it for the "normal" tone (this is the Jason Simon trick/Dead Meadowisms)
